The best of ecotourism in Cuba

Cuba It is a wonderful place to develop various activities related to ecotourism practically 365 days a year.

One of them is the bird watching, since the island has the warm climate in relation to its exotic Caribbean location, which makes Cuba one of the best places in the world for bird watching.

It should be noted that Cuba has 350 native species of birds, the smallest bird in the world is Cuban Hummingbird Bee. The main location is the Guanahacabibes Peninsula, western end of Pinar del Río and the Ciénaga de Zapata, in Montemar Park, which is the main nucleus of the Biosphere Reserve and Ramsar is one of the best birdwatching areas in the Caribbean.

This great variety of habitats provides a wide diversity of birds within a relatively short distance. Also to the east of Cuba, the Sierra Masetra National Park is the ideal place for bird watching activities.

Few landscapes in Cuba are by nature as beautiful as Viñales, in the province of Pinar del Río which is the most famous tobacco region of Cuba. And it is that the Viñales Valley has unique characteristics, such as the mountains of the Valley, the archaeological sites of the Sierra del Rosario.

The area is also ideal for hiking with various paths that lead to the San Juan de Campismo baths through the ruins of La Victoria, an old coffee plantation.

There the visitor can stay at the Hotel Moka, which is a romantic and unique hotel, located in the middle of the wooded hills of Las Terrazas on the impressive lake, surrounded by nature, overlooking the heart of the Sierra del Rosario mountains. .
